Elder ties up with Chase movie

Elder Health Care Ltd has tied with movie Chase. Company's product Fuel deo is in the co-branding pact. As a part of its strategy to have a direct connect with its consumers, Fuel the successful deodarant brand from Elder Health Care Ltd, (EHCL) has entered into a co-branding pact with Chase, an action packed thriller produced by Maverick Productions.

Fuel brand positioning of seduction and passion is very close the movie's plot which involves a lot of passionate scenes between its leading man Anuuj Saxena and his female counterparts Udita Goswami and Tarina Patel. Fuel, a part of Elder Health Care Ltd, moves with an image of male style and class that emanates passion and attraction towards women. Fuel enjoys a market share of about 3.5 % in the Rs 500 cr.

Indian deodorant market. Released on 29th April 2010, Chase is targeted at today's young generation with fast paced action, a few seductive scenes and a strong story plot.

With the grooming market in India currently estimated at Rs1,500 cores, and growing at 12 per cent compound annual growth rate. Elder Health Care has taken an initiative to space in smoothly with a range of innovative products.

Apart from this the company is also running a contest in all prominent self service stores where customers who are buying Fuel deos get a chance to win Chase movie tickets for two. There are 1500 tickets up for grabs in major Indian cities including Delhi, Mumbai, Bangalore, Hyderabad and Pune. An on air contest involving Fuel and Chase is currently running on B4U music channel where 1 lucky winner can get the mind blowing sports bike similar to what the lead actor Anuuj Saxena rides in the movie.

What's more, 100's of lucky winners participating in Fuel- chase on road campaigns will get to win cool Fuel 'Chase co branded deodorants and merchandise.
